Their size determines the color. The larger the radius of each nanocrystal, the more red the color is. The actual nanocrystal can be made up of lots of different things, Cadmium and Selenium/Indium and Phosphide/Zinc and Sulfur to name a few. Cadmium Selenide dots have always performed best because of their chemical characteristics. I imagine they lowered the cadmium content and alloyed another sort of metal in there as well. Fine-tuning probably got it to the performance metrics they're looking for.
